What We’re Defending Against
Low-cost drones are enabling smuggling, espionage, and coordinated attacks, turning airspace into the new scene of crime.
Covert Surveillance
Criminals and hostile actors use drones to reconnaissance targets, gather intelligence on police routines, and plan attacks
Evidence Tampering & Scene Compromise
Drones can film, disturb, or remove evidence at crime scenes, complicating prosecutions
Delivery of Contraband or Weapons
UAVs enable remote delivery of drugs, weapons, or other contraband into otherwise secure areas (prisons, checkpoints, event perimeters)
Public Order & Mass-Event Disruption
Drones over protests, sporting events, or large gatherings can cause panic, enable incitement, or be used to ignite disturbances

Drone Incursions at Prisons
A growing number of police forces globally report drone-related incidents that hamper prison safety and fuel crime

Georgia phone scam
Drones were used to drop cellphones into a Georgia prisons
- A prison inmate ran a call center using a smuggled phone
- Smuggled phone was used to defraud female healthcare workers
- A victim lost more than $500k to the scam

Drug drop in Canadian prison
A maximum security prison in Canada discovered a huge payload of drugs in Dec 2024
- About $400k worth of drugs were dropped via drone
- Crystal meth, marijuana and MDMA among drugs recovered
- The drone was never captured

Drones spotted near Indian prisons
Authorities have spotted drones loitering near Indian prisons in recent times
- Chinese drone discovered in Bhopal jail in Nov 2025, close to cells housing terror suspects
- In Jan 2026, an unidentified flying object was spotted at Kannur prison, near the women’s block
